The Challenge of Energy Consumption in Crypto Mining

Crypto mining has long been criticized for its significant energy usage and environmental impact. Traditional mining operations consume enormous amounts of electricity, often relying on fossil fuels, leading to high carbon footprints. This has triggered increasing scrutiny from regulators and investors alike, demanding cleaner, more sustainable approaches.
